A Recursive approach to the matrix moment problem

Functional Analysis 2024-01-02 v2

Abstract

In this paper, we study the truncated matrix moment problem in one variable through recursive matrix extensions. \ We give necessary and sufficient conditions for a recursive matrix extension of finite data to be a matrix moment sequence in the classical cases of Hamburger, Stieltjes, and Hausdorff moment problems. \ We also discuss matricial subnormal completion and matricial kk--hyponormal completion problems and provide an analog of Stampfli's Theorem on flat propagation for 22--hyponormal matricial weighted shifts.
